madisongrrl 08-26-2015 07:36 PM

Quote:

Originally Posted by Albertakewl (Post 1166010)
And with small fiber , do you have normal reflex with it?

With small fiber you would have normal reflexes, but an individual could have other things going on in addition to their SFN.
